When the Queensland Police were faced with the loss of one of their own, Chief Inspector Corey Allen began to take a hard look at what it means to provide true peer support. Today, the agency prides itself on making sure that every officer feels supported through the stresses and pressures of their job. “We’ve made sure it wasn’t in vain.”
